A Comparison of the Effects of Young-Child Formulas and Cow’s Milk on Nutrient Intakes in Polish Children Aged 13–24 Months

Adequately balanced daily food rations that provide the body with sufficient amounts of energy and nutrients, including minerals, are particularly important in early childhood when rapid physical, intellectual and motor development takes place.
